For the ganache:
In a bowl, put the chopped chocolate and melt it in a bain-marie or in the microwave for 30 seconds.
Add the cream and mix well to obtain a shiny cream.

IMPORTANT MEASUREMENTS:
BUTTER: 1 cup = 225g | 1 tbsp = 15g
WHEAT FLOUR: 1 cup = 130g | 1 tbsp = 8g
SUGAR: 1 cup = 210g | 1 tbsp = 15 g
